Leaking Sprinkler Repair in Ventura County, CA

Leaking sprinkler repair services address issues related to water escaping from sprinkler system components, which can lead to water waste, increased utility bills, and potential damage to landscaping. This service covers a variety of projects, including fixing broken or cracked pipes, repairing damaged sprinkler heads, replacing faulty valves, and addressing leaks in control zones. Property owners often seek this service when noticing persistent wet spots, unusually high water bills, or areas of their lawn that are overly saturated or dry despite regular watering schedules.

Before requesting leaking sprinkler repairs, homeowners should understand the location and extent of the leak, as well as any recent changes to the sprinkler system or landscape. Identifying specific problem areas and providing details about the system’s age and configuration can help ensure an efficient diagnosis and repair process. Proper maintenance and timely repairs can help maintain an efficient irrigation system, conserve water, and protect the landscape’s health.

FAQ

Leaking Sprinkler Repair Questions

What causes sprinkler leaks? Leaks can result from damaged pipes, worn-out seals, or broken sprinkler heads, often due to age or weather conditions.

How can I tell if my sprinkler system is leaking? Signs include pooling water, unusually high water bills, or areas of the lawn that are overly wet or muddy.

What types of sprinkler leaks are common to repair? Common repairs involve replacing broken heads, sealing pipe cracks, or fixing faulty valves to stop leaks effectively.

Is it necessary to shut off the sprinkler system during repairs? Yes, shutting off the system prevents further water loss and makes repairs safer and easier to perform.
